About Kolkata

Formerly called Calcutta, Kolkata served as the capital of British India for more than a century. The history of the city has left it with a rich colonial legacy, which can be witnessed in its architecture. The local festivals celebrated with great gusto also draw culture enthusiasts in hordes. Durga Puja is an especially good time to plan a trip to Kolkata as that’s when the festive winds are at their strongest. Places to see in Kolkata

Victoria Memorial – Victoria Memorial, one of the most prominent tourist attractions in Kolkata, was built between 1906 and 1921 to commemorate the 25-year reign of Queen Victoria in India. It is a stunning white building which gives a glimpse into the colonial past of Kolkata.
Howrah Bridge – If it is your first visit to the City of Joy, then a visit to the iconic Howrah Bridge is a must. The suspension bridge, built over the Hooghly River, has been dominating the map of Kolkata for more than half a century.
Indian Museum – Established in 1814, the Indian Museum is one of the earliest and largest multipurpose museums in the Asia-Pacific region. Its vast collection includes some rare Mughal paintings, armours, ornaments, fossils and other artefacts.
Marble Palace – Counted among the top tourist attractions in Kolkata, Marble Palace was built by Raja Rajendra Mullick in the year 1835. The palace also boasts a rich collection of Victorian furniture and Western sculptures.
Birla Mandir – Birla Mandir is one of the biggest centres of spirituality and religion in Kolkata. The splendid architecture of the shrine showcases the traditional Rajasthani style. The sheer grandeur of the temple will leave you spellbound.

Best time to visit Kolkata

The autumn and winter seasons are perfect to explore the city of Kolkata as this is when the local weather is at its absolute best. A number of festivals also fall between the months of October and February, giving you a chance to soak in the richness of the culture of the local people. Visit around Durga Puja to witness the culture of Kolkata at its best.

Places to See in Chennai

Marina Beach – Marina Beach is one of the most sought-after hotspots in India, remaining swamped with locals as well as tourists. It is also the longest beach in the country, stretching a total of 13 km. A wide array of activities can be enjoyed at the beach. Beach lovers, be booking a cheap flight to Chennai already.
Fort Saint George – Completed in 1653 by the British, today, Fort Saint George is the home of Tamil Nadu Legislative Assembly. It houses the splendid Saint Mary’s Church, which is believed to be one of the oldest surviving churches built in the colonial era. The on-site museum exhibits an impressive collection of paintings, relics and other artefacts.
Santhome Cathedral Basilica – Santhome Cathedral Basilica is one of the only three basilicas built over the tomb of an apostle. It was built back in 1523 by the Portuguese and showcases the neo-gothic style of architecture.
T. Nagar – T. Nagar or Thyagaraya Nagar is the premier shopping district in Chennai that is replete with stores and street vendors offering everything from jewellery and clothes to delectable food. You can also buy traditional colourful sarees.
Edward Elliot’s Beach – If Marina Beach proves to be too crowded for you, then Edward Elliot’s Beach can be the perfect pick for you. The glowing brown sands of the beach are dominated by a white monument called Karl Schmidt Memorial built in the memory of a sailor who drowned here in 1930 while attempting to save the life of a girl.

Best time to visit Chennai

The weather in Chennai can be quite hot and humid during the summer season. Plan your visit during the winter season between the months of November and February to explore the city in pleasant weather. It is recommended that you book your flight tickets in advance.
